Output d068de7914848c50841623425ea35b4015cc59e24f0e171a7bfae5337a0cfda6:0

value
889160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6afd654d878c344c8448ca40ce6faa8a0d203daf OP_EQUAL
address
3BSj77xAT8BEYbVqJFakabCT7f6UTrpVE1
transaction
d068de7914848c50841623425ea35b4015cc59e24f0e171a7bfae5337a0cfda6
spent
true